What is the definition of online payroll software?

Online payroll software and online payroll services are nearly identical. Payroll software is the cloud-based solution supplied by the online payroll service provider; in other words, it is the interface you use to run payroll and add new employees to the system. The majority of online payroll software is simple to use and allows you to complete payroll in minutes.

What is an example of a payroll tax?

The Federal Insurance Contributions Act (FICA) tax is an example of a payroll tax. This is a mandatory payroll deduction that employers must pay to the IRS to fund employees’ Social Security retirement benefits and Medicare.

1. ADP

ADP is a scalable platform that includes all of the capabilities essential to manage a complicated business, such as one operating in a highly regulated industry or across state or even national borders. ADP is applicable to a wide variety of industries and verticals, making it an excellent solution for enterprises with complex or broad-ranging demands.

This organization specializes in providing payroll solutions for small, medium-sized, and big businesses. Its Run platform is geared at small enterprises with less than 50 employees, while its Workforce Now platform is geared toward medium-sized businesses with 50 to 999 employees. Businesses with more than 1,000 employees can choose from a variety of platforms, including the Enterprise platform.

2. Paychex

Paychex also accepts payment via direct deposit, paper checks, and prepaid debit cards. Each payment method your business employs with Paychex may be customized, ensuring that your business is always top-of-mind for any suppliers or other third parties you pay.

Paychex is a cloud-based solution, which means it is available via the Internet. Additionally, you may manage your payroll using the Paychex mobile application on any iOS or Android device. Paychex makes payroll processing simple by allowing you to enter payroll data (such as salary, hours worked, and pay rates) and submitting the payroll for processing. Paychex also offers self-service to employees, allowing them to log in and view their own pay stubs and year-end tax forms.

3. OnPay

Small businesses can use OnPay’s online payroll services to run an unlimited number of payrolls per month and pay employees through direct deposit or paper check. The online system is user-friendly and simplifies the process of managing paid time off (PTO).

When you own a very small business, time is very valuable; managing your own payroll would divert your attention away from your business, and a huge and complex payroll platform would be incompatible with your organization’s demands. OnPay is the ideal answer for extremely small businesses, offering an easy-to-use system that emphasizes simplicity without losing value.

OnPay customer support representatives are available to assist you at any time. You can benefit from an intuitive platform that simplifies payroll administration. It’s simple to add employees, modify their statuses, and run payroll.

4. Rippling

Rippling’s online payroll software features an intuitive interface that requires minimal training for new users. Payroll processing is so straightforward that it can be completed in 90 seconds – a credit to the variety of data sources used by Rippling. It integrates with over 400 other applications to help you optimize payroll processing, payroll tax preparation, and accounting.

On the dashboard, critical metrics such as employee time worked, paid time off, and overall labour expenses are neatly grouped. Direct deposits can be managed directly in Rippling, or paper checks can be used — whatever manner your employees prefer. Rippling deducts tax withholdings automatically based on an employee’s filing status.

5. Square

Square is best known as a payment processing platform, but the company also provides an online payroll solution. Square Payroll is a straightforward piece of software with few frills. It offers all of the capabilities we were looking for in a payroll software firm, but it still has the lightweight feel that its payment processing cousin is known for.

Square Payroll may be used to process payroll for W-2 workers as well as 1099 contractors. It simplifies payroll by automating the preparation of tax forms based on data already stored in your system. It also provides a simple payroll processing routine, making it simple to ensure that all types of employees are paid on time.

6. Gusto

Gusto manages all payroll and payroll tax obligations for both W-2 employees and 1099 independent contractors and freelancers. The cloud-based system is simple to use and has a number of useful features, such as direct deposit, an autopilot tool, new hire reporting, and thorough payroll summaries.

A distinguishing aspect of this payroll service is the extensive selection of human resources tools and capabilities included in some of the more expensive plans. These features include access to human resource professionals who can advise and assist you with a variety of human resource-related concerns.

7. Zenefits

Zenefits provides simple payroll software that allows you to run payroll in four simple steps. When running payroll, it is also simple to make manual adjustments, such as incorporating bonuses. Zenefits Payroll provides unlimited payroll processing, wage garnishment assistance, direct deposits, tip reporting, different pay schedules and rate tables, 1099 contractor payments, general ledger reports, and mobile pay stubs.

Zenefits Payroll works in tandem with other Zenefits HR modules such as Time and Scheduling, Benefits, and HR. In this scenario, Zenefits Payroll performs best since these connectors extend its capability and it relies extensively on data from other modules to conduct payroll.

8. QuickBooks

QuickBooks by Intuit Payroll offers scalable payroll services that are small to combine with QuickBooks. All payroll taxes are collected and reported through the service, which also provides a number of useful features. It is available in a variety of plans with varying services and costs.

QuickBooks Payroll has some of the most flexible payroll plan options among the providers we looked at. The services are divided into two categories: online payroll and desktop payroll, both of which can be enhanced with QuickBooks accounting software. This allows you to obtain additional services in a single subscription.

While some plans are primarily focused on payroll processing, others incorporate a number of human resources services that are beneficial to small firms who do not have the luxury of an in-house HR team. Each package comes with a 30-day free trial.

9. Paycor

Paycor provides user-friendly online payroll software with an employee self-service portal for reviewing compensation data and amending personal or financial information. Employees can also utilize the platform to request paid time off, track payments, examine benefits, and view pay stubs.

Paycor has three price schemes, each with a monthly flat charge. In the online payroll software market, most providers charge a monthly base rate plus a monthly per-employee fee. Paycor’s strategy may be prohibitively expensive for tiny organizations, but it may save money for middle and large businesses as they grow.

10. Wave

Wave Payroll is our best pricing option because they have a fixed charge based on your state, rather than increasing the price based on feature levels. Wave also provides free accounting and invoicing software that can be combined with Payroll, making it an even more cost-effective solution. Wave provides basic payroll software that is simple to use, and you can test it out for free for 30 days. The only disadvantage is that free tax filing is only accessible in 14 states.

Wave has received average online customer service reviews. Many people report that Wave was unhelpful when they called in, however the majority of feedback appear to be related to their payments product. Customers can get help by submitting a support ticket, using a chatbot, live chat, or visiting a Help Center containing articles and tutorials.
